The latest iteration of TerminusGPS, a versatile Python library designed to simplify interactions with various APIs, has been released. Version 55.2.0 is now available, bringing with it a host of enhancements and new features that promise to streamline GPS-related development projects.
At its core, TerminusGPS provides a suite of abstractions and utilities for working with a range of APIs, including the Wialon API, Authorize.NET API, and AWS API, among others. This release continues the library's tradition of simplifying complex API interactions, making it an indispensable tool for developers working on projects that involve GPS tracking, payment processing, and cloud services.
